Contractual Agreements
The majority of our projects are provided on a fixed-fee basis where a Scope of
Services has been mutually developed by the client and Acoustical Design
Collaborative, Ltd. Certain projects, such as those involving corrective
acoustical design, are best handled by an initial investigative phase followed
by a corrective design phase where the Scope of Services can be more assuredly
determined.Our services can be retained in a variety of contractual ways. Most projects are
secured using a written Proposal prepared by Acoustical Design Collaborative,
Ltd, outlining our Scope of Services and Fees that becomes a basic form of
agreement through client countersignature.
Architects can issue AIA form C141, C142, or C727 while commercial,
governmental, or institutional clients can issue a Purchase Order. We recommend
our Proposal be included with the contractual agreement to describe services to
be provided.Acoustical Design Collaborative, Ltd maintains professional liability and
comprehensive general liability insurance. Insurance certificates from our
carriers can be issued to the client when necessary. |
